Scope and Content

Papers and correspondence of H.J.R. Murray, relating to chess and board games, consisting of:  

  • Transcripts of manuscripts and printed works, mainly copied from items owned by J.G. White
  • Collections of problems and games
  • Papers on chess by Murray
  • Papers on chess by other writers
  • Collections and notes by Murray
  • Papers relating to draughts
  • Papers relating to other board games
  • Correspondence

Administrative / Biographical History

Harold James Ruthven Murray (1868-1955) was a chess player and historian of chess and board games. He was the author of A history of chess (Oxford, 1913) and A history of board games (Oxford, 1952).

Acquisition Information

The papers were given to the Library with a collection of printed books and Oriental manuscripts in 1955.
